The Impact of Bruxism (Teeth Grinding) on Your Dental Health
Bruxism, more commonly known as teeth grinding, is a widespread condition that has potentially severe implications for your dental health. This condition, often occurring unconsciously during sleep or in times of stress, is a habit many individuals may not even be aware they possess. However, its impact on oral health is substantial and should not be overlooked.
The act of teeth grinding involves the constant gnashing, grinding, or clenching of teeth. While it can occur during the day, most instances happen at night when the person is not consciously able to control it. One of the most immediate and apparent effects of bruxism is the wear and tear it inflicts on the teeth. Persistent grinding can lead to the erosion of enamel - the hard, protective outer layer of the teeth. This erosion leaves the teeth vulnerable to cavities and decay. In severe cases, the consistent pressure exerted by grinding can lead to the fracturing or even complete loss of teeth.
Beyond the direct damage to teeth, bruxism can also have detrimental effects on the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), which acts as a hinge connecting your jaw to your skull. This joint is crucial for activities like talking and eating. Chronic grinding places stress on the TMJ, potentially leading to a group of conditions known as temporomandibular joint disorders (TMD). Symptoms of TMD can range from mild discomfort to severe pain and include jaw pain, headaches, and difficulty opening and closing the mouth.
Additionally, the effects of bruxism aren't confined to the mouth. Given that the condition frequently occurs during sleep, it can also result in disrupted sleep patterns. The implications of poor sleep can be broad, including daytime fatigue, mood changes, and even weakened immunity.

Diagnosis typically involves an examination of your teeth and jaw for signs of bruxism, such as wear and tear on the teeth, and an assessment of your symptoms and sleep habits.
Once bruxism is diagnosed, there are several strategies available to manage the condition and limit its impact on your dental health. These may include stress management and relaxation techniques if stress is identified as a trigger. Wearing a custom-made mouthguard at night can protect your teeth from the effects of grinding while you sleep. In some cases, dental procedures may be necessary to repair damaged teeth or adjust the bite to reduce grinding.

FAQs
Q: What are the symptoms of bruxism?
A: Symptoms of bruxism can include worn tooth enamel, increased tooth sensitivity, jaw pain, headaches, and disrupted sleep. If you're experiencing any of these symptoms, it's essential to consult with a dental professional.
Q: Can bruxism be cured?
A: While there isn't a cure for bruxism, its symptoms can be effectively managed. The best dentists in India can provide various treatments, including mouthguards, stress management techniques, and in some cases, dental procedures.
Q: How is bruxism diagnosed?
A: Bruxism is typically diagnosed by a dentist through a combination of dental examination, discussion of symptoms, and review of your sleep habits. The dentist will look for signs of wear and tear on your teeth and may ask about any related symptoms like jaw pain or headaches.
Q: What treatments are available for bruxism?
A: Treatments for bruxism are varied and depend on the severity of the condition. A custom-made mouthguard can help protect your teeth during sleep. If stress or anxiety is a contributing factor, stress management and relaxation techniques may be recommended. In some cases, dental procedures may be necessary to repair damaged teeth or adjust the bite.
Q: How does bruxism impact overall health?
A: Besides its effect on dental health, bruxism can also disrupt sleep and lead to headaches, facial pain, and temporomandibular joint disorders. If left untreated, chronic sleep disruption can lead to broader health issues like fatigue and mood changes.
